PostPosted: Thu, 30th Aug 2007 00:43    Post subject: torrentspy blocks US visitors from now on
http://tspy.blogspot.com/2007/08/torrentspy-acts-to-protect-privacy.html

Quote:
Torrentspy's decision to stop accepting US visitors was NOT compelled by any Court rather it arises out of an uncertain legal climate in the United States regarding user privacy and the apparent tension between US and European Union Internet privacy laws.
